How To Find Barnwood Wall Ideas For Your Home

Let’s be real, looking at these fun barnwood wall ideas may be inspiring, but it’s much harder to find the right style for your own home. This is because your home style and taste is unique to you. So if you want to make finding the right wood wall accent easier, here are three things you can do.

  1. Simplify the room. A barnwood wall will be the statement piece in any room. If the place you are adding it to is busy with other design features, your new wall may get lost in the mess. So it’s essential to simplify the room before you install your barnwood wall accent piece. 
  2. Use complementary colors. Make sure the colors you incorporate not only complement the barnwood wall but lay a foundation for it to shine its brightest. Colors like white or grey lay a perfect canvas for most any accent walls. Consider the other design elements in the room when choosing a color for your foundational walls.
  3. Embrace minimalism. This theme is found in the previous two points, but it’s worth emphasizing. Minimalism lets your accent pieces shine. It says, “focus on this one design element.” It naturally focuses the eye on the most stylish piece in the room: your barnwood wall. So declutter, go minimal, and let your wall stand out.
